But I mostly agree with Copenjin. Interviews are less about on the spot skill checks so much as learning how someone thinks and problem solves. Honestly, you could play a boardgame/videogame/cardgame with them and it would be an effective interview (asking them relevant questions during the game, and maybe even better if it's a relatively unknown game so they can zero shot it). The reason for this is that in real world work you are more concerned with how someone adapts to changing environments and thinks through situations. To see when they'll ask for help, what they might get stuck on, and how they strategize.
Your employees will always be gaining new skills. And honestly, it is easier to take a lower skilled person who's more adaptable and driven and turn them into a great employee than it is to take someone who's got skills but will stagnate. But ymmv depending on the job and requirements. Sometimes you just need to fill a seat.

if you play a board game with someone you can assess their general intelligence and capacity for logic. all else being equal, having more general intelligence and knowing how to think logically do make you a better programmer. (if you just want to assess general intelligence, a much faster pair of tests would be reverse digit span and reaction time.) but those are far from the only things that matter, they're not enough to be a great programmer, and they're not even among the most important factors. other important factors in programming include things like knowing how to program, knowing how to listen, and being willing to ask for help (and accept it), which a board game generally will not test

But at the end of the day, I think the underlying issue is that we're testing the wrong things. If GPT can do sufficient, then what do we need the human for? Well... the actual coding, logic, and nuance. So we need to really see how a human performs in those domains. Your interviewing process should adapt with the times. It is like having a calculus exam where you test someone and ban calculators but also include a lot of rote, mundane, and arduous arithmetic calculations. That isn't testing the material that the course is on and isn't making anyone a better mathematician, because any mathematician in the wild will still use a calculator (mathematicians and physicists are often far more concerned with symbolic manipulation than numerals).
